Why Texas Women Vote

Their agenda has already caused so much damage, and women have paid the price. Years of these policies have caused numerous abortion providers to close, leaving women without meaningful access to abortion in vast parts of the state, such as the Rio Grande Valley. More than 70 family planning health centers have closed or stopped providing family planning services.

Thousands of women lost access to health care after the state banned Planned Parenthood from the Texas Women’s Health Program — this is on top of 155,000 women who lost access to care due to the legislature’s cruel and dangerous budget cuts.

All across Texas, women are just flat-out going without care.
